Total Crime Rate
658.0 per 1,000
All offences Β·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Milton Road area has the highest crime rate of 102 local areas in Bobbing, Iwade and Lower Halstow , and the 7th highest crime rate of 454 local areas in Swale .
This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Milton Road (ME10 3EX) in the last 12 months was 658.0 per 1,000 residents and was 918.0% higher than the Bobbing, Iwade and Lower Halstow average (64.6 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this areaβs most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 83 offences recorded. The least common crime was Bicycle theft with 1 case , down -80.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Shoplifting ( 68.8% YoY). The sharpest decline was Bicycle theft ( -80.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 86 (β 186.1 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-29.5%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-34.4%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Milton Road (ME10 3EX), the main crime hotspot is near Parking Area. Police recorded 326 crimes here, including 77 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
